One of the common expressions apart for flu symptoms, cough and breathing difficulty, in a group of patients in any age group, is the tendency to of the blood to clot anywhere in the blood vessels secondary to being Covid19 positive. The exact mechanism is being investigated. But this tendency results in strokes, heart attacks, and various other complications caused by Blood Clots in the blood vessels - Dr. Leela
read this article: EXCERPT - "The analyses suggest coronavirus patients are mostly experiencing the deadliest type of stroke. Known as large vessel occlusions, or LVOs, they can obliterate large parts of the brain responsible for movement, speech and decision-making in one blow because they are in the main blood-supplying arteries.
Many researchers suspect strokes in covid-19 patients may be a direct consequence of blood problems that are producing clots all over some people’s bodies.
Clots that form on vessel walls fly upward. One that started in the calves might migrate to the lungs, causing a blockage called a pulmonary embolism that arrests breathing — a known cause of death in covid-19 patients. Clots in or near the heart might lead to a heart attack, another common cause of death. Anything above that would probably go to the brain, leading to a stroke."
